A Study on Water Pollution of the Physio-chemical Conditonns and Phytoplankton of the Han River

Abstract
For the purpose of studying the relationship between physio-chemical conditions and water quality level by phytoplankton of the Han River (running through Seoul), a study was conducted at 8 sampling points during the period from June 6 to July 2, 1974. Examination of physio-chemical water analysis such as temperature, pH, DO, BOD, Cl- and biological analysis has shown:
1. Water temperature was 18.5¡­20.5¡É(June 6¡­ June 7) and 22¡­26¡É(June 30¡­July 2).
2. Water depth was 11.5m at the first Han River bridge, 8.1m at kwangjang and between 3¡­4m in other sampling points.
3. At all points pH was in the range of 7.0¡­7.4 except Duksum and Bokwangdong where it was 7.5¡­7.7.
4. DO was generally high; 5.3¡­9.0mg/§¤. But at Nanjido and haengju was 3.3¡­6.2mg/§¤.
5. Kwangjang and Duksum were not above the BOD criterion (4.0mg/§¤ at the source of water supply), though high enough for Bokwangdong 10.3mg/§¤and Nanjido 29.0mg/§¤.
6. BOD at the river side was 4.5¡­10.2mg/§¤and at the center as 3.5¡­7.0mg/§¤. It means that pollution diffused from river side to center.
7. Salinity of Nanjido was very high; 26.9¡­33.3%
8. Among the classified phytoplankton, Coscinodiscus nitidus, Coscinodiscus radiatus and Triceratium favus are marine water planktons which were found at Heangju only. It means the intrusion of marine water.
9. At Kwangjang and Jamsil and Duksum which BOD was 3.5¡­5.3mg/§¤, dominant species were Fragilaria consturens var venter and Diatoma elongatum belonging Chrysophyta. At Bokwangdong, the first Han River bridge and the second Han River bridge which BOD was 6.0¡­10.3mg/§¤, dominant species were Cymbella ventricosa, Nitazchia palea and Synedra ulna belonging Chrysophyta and Oscillatoria tenuis belonging Chrysophyta. At Nanjido which BOD was 29.0mg/§¤. domonant species were Eugenal spp. beloning Euglenophyta.
10. The results of biological water analysis by saprobic system were as follows; Kwangjang was Oligosaprobic, Jamsil and Duksum were r-mesosaprobic, Bokwangdong and the first Han River bridge were ¥á-mesosaprobic, and the second Han River bridge, Nanjido and Heangju were from r-polysaprobic to
¥â-polysaprobic.
